Pulls too much current
I have a Sony XAV-AX1000 radio and its max current output on the USB port is 1.5A which is pretty much standard across USB 3.0 ports. This device is either shorted internally or draws too much power from the port. When I installed it after about 20 seconds my radio turned itself off and then powered itself back on and all settings were reset to default (as if the battery was disconnected). I removed the device and it was quite warm to the touch. I plugged in my old wireless carplay dongle and the radio stayed powered on. To confirm its a defective Autosky dongle I reinstalled it into the port and after a few seconds my radio powered itself back off and then back on. The only reason why I bought this Autosky one is because of the size. The one this one was going to replace works perfectly but its bulky and gets in the way of the volume knob. Personally I would not recommend this brand due to the issues I encountered. Others have mentioned in their reviews their units get hot too.

AutoSky Wireless Adapter works on a 2023 Harley Davidson RGL
I would have given this 5 stars but I had trouble getting it to connect to my motorcycle. I got it to work but the instructions were not straight forward. Here are a few things that may help someone else.Your iPhone must connect to the autosky adapter via a Wi-Fi connection. I followed the instructions multiple times and got frustrated with the server stopped responding error message enough to contact the Mfg. but before they could contact me, I got it to work.I decided to connect my adapter to my computer to ensure constant power is available to the adapter. Connect to the server by connecting your iPhone to the adapter via Wi-Fi and Bluetooth. Connection to both must be done before you can connect to the AutoSky server. Once I did this, the adapter page came right up. Scroll down to the Upgrade menu and if there is an update for your adapter, select it to start the download. Once successfully completed, unplug your adapter and plug it back it. If you want to, you can recheck the server page but I don't think it was really necessary.Once my adapter was updated, I went back to the garage and plugged it into my motorcycle. Don't forget that you must connect to the adapter via it's Wi-Fi connection. This time, you only need to make that Wi-Fi connection. The Carplay screen came up within seconds. The rest is history they say. Carplay was working flawlessly. I turned my bike off and waited a minute or two and turned it back on. Carplay came up within seconds.In short, once you get your adapter updated, only if needed, connect your iPhone to the adapter via the WI-Fi connection, you should be able to see the carplay screen at this point. One last thing. In case other HD motorcyclists aren't aware of this, the Carplay plug in adapter/connector must be connected to the WHIM connector under your front fairing. This plus the AutoSky wireless adapter works to get Carplay on our 2019 and up bike.Good luck guys. This thing rocks.

Worked great for a while. Can't reliably connect any more.
After installing the latest update by plugging it into a computer and accessing the unit over wifi, it connected to my 2018 Outback about 95% of the time. Very happy with the performance (there is a slight lag in controls having an effect, but that's the price of the wireless workaround).The last month, I can barely get it to connect maybe one time out of 6 or 7. I've factory reset it, tweaked the connection delay, tried other connection settings seen on troubleshooting sites and nothing. I gave up and reconnected directly to car via bluetooth so I could at least listen to podcasts. (my wired connection doesn't work... bad lightning port)Today I decided to really try to fix it. I disconnected the phone from the home wifi, disconnected my Apple Watch so there's zero other Bluetooth connections (wifi was on and watch was always connected back in the "good times" and didn't seem to matter) and sat out in the car, turning it on and off. I still can't get it to reliably connect. I tried the most recent software update on the setting page and no difference.At the end of the troubleshooting guide, they said to contact them for help. I went to the Amazon page to get product support and my support window had passed less than five days ago. So ... do your trouble shooting asap, I suppose.
